Catfish & The Bottlemen will now be Ireland during their headline tour which starts in Hull next month, playing the Dublin Olympia on May 16th.

The band have also been confirmed as the main support for Noel Gallagher when the former Oasis man headlines the Belsonic 2016 series of gigs at the Titanic Belfast on August 23rd. It’s a new venue for the event, and promoter Alan Simms has said.

“In previous years we found that a large portion, around 50% of the show was sold out, leaving a lot of fans not being able to see their favourite acts so we have been keeping an eye out for somewhere bigger but that is also a landmark site.”

Catifsh & The Bottlemen release their second album ‘The Ride’ on May 27th – recorded with Gallagher’s one-time studio cohort Dave Sardy.
